Those neon's srt's are gonna be killer i think i am going to have to upgrade my cvic for a talon in the near future so i don't get embaressed by one of these on the street. Sport compact magazine tested one already it put out 250 lb/ft torque on the dyno and around 225whp WOW!!! It covered the 1/4 mile in 14.2 sec and 0- 60 will give wrx drivers a run for their money 5.8 sec. It will sell for 20k US. These stock cars are getting just too quick, this sport compact industry has really developed into a huge market, next thing you know every body will be trading in their suv's for these neons haha.
